The MRI Technologist must have enhanced knowledge in the area of MRI, possessing the specific expertise and skills necessary for maintaining a safe MRI environment daily. They must understand basic anatomy, physiology, and physics as it pertains to MRI patient care. This role involves providing imaging services and transportation to patients of all ages, from neonate to geriatric, and ensuring thorough explanations and adequate communication with patients and their families. The technologist is responsible for upholding all safety standards, following established protocols, and observing JCAHO standards. Prioritizing customer and patient satisfaction using AIDET principles and collaborating with other departments are key aspects of the role. The technologist will also utilize I Care principles for proper patient identification and exam accuracy, practice good stewardship of resources, and adhere to MRI zone safety and screening processes. Knowledge of MR language, scheduling, and administering contrast/medications according to policy is required. The role involves correlating clinical history with exams, participating in MRI QC, maintaining accreditation, and managing inventory and supplies. They will also instruct and supervise students and new employees, and may be assigned call duties. Charge techs or lead techs will coordinate services, act as a contact person, and inform other shifts of changes. Per Diem staff have specific holiday and availability requirements. The technologist must function proficiently with little or no supervision and adhere to DCH Standards, including performance, patient and employee satisfaction, financial standards, compliance, and behavioral standards. They must ensure the safety of patients, visitors, and employees by identifying and reducing unsafe practices and risks. Use of electronic mail, time and attendance software, learning management software, and intranet is required, along with adherence to all DCH Health System policies and procedures.
